A: If and when a catastrophe occurs, documentation is the key factor in determining compensation from an insurance claim. Property claims are handled based on “assumptions” and “standards”. While your insurance company may “assume” you have a color TV in your family room, they may also “assume” it is a “standard” 27” worth around $400. The reality is you may own a 42” plasma screen TV valued at over $6500. Our inventory can also help you evaluate whether you are properly insured.

As a general rule insurance companies insure the contents of your home for 80% of the value of the house. They know that you have many valuable items that you use everyday. A: A home inventory for a 2,000 sq. ft. home with an average amount of furnishings takes approximately 2 to 4 hours to document its general contents. If you have a larger home, business or special collections, the amount of time spent performing the in-home or in business portion of the services can vary depending upon what specific items the homeowner or business wants documented. We only inventory when you are present for liability reasons but also to get more detailed information that may impact the item's sentimental or actual value.
